Who We Are

We are a non-profit registered Society dedicated to the protection and enhancement of wild sheep and wild sheep habitat throughout “Beautiful British Columbia”.

BC is very fortunate to be home to the largest and most diverse populations of wild sheep of any of the provinces, states or territories in North America. From the dry desert-like climate of the southern interior to the glacial northernmost corner along the Yukon border, you can find 4 sub-species of sheep spread across this beautiful province. They have adapted to and thrive in some of the harshest environments and continue to be an iconic symbol of our BC wilderness.​
